To celebrate and pay homage, here are some of my favourite quotes of his about the pleasure and pain of being a writer…
“Forget your personal tragedy. We are all bitched from the start and you especially have to be hurt like hell before you can write seriously. But when you get the damned hurt, use it-don’t cheat with it.”
“As a writer, you should not judge, you should understand.”
“Never confuse movement with action.”
“All you have to do is write one true sentence. Write the truest sentence that you know.”
“Write drunk; edit sober.”
“The first draft of anything is shit.”
“There is nothing to writing. All you do is sit down at a typewriter and bleed.”
Ernest Hemingway, 1899 – 1961
